About The Position

The PACU RN is responsible for managing all nursing care provided immediately post-operative. This role requires the ability to make intelligent, independent decisions across all aspects of PACU Nursing, along with a working knowledge of surgical procedures and the technical equipment used for monitoring and delivering care.

Requirements

  • Graduate of an accredited school of nursing
  • Certification in Basic Life Support
  • Certification in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S)
  • Current North Carolina license as a registered nurse
  • At least two (2) years of recent PACU or critical care experience that has afforded a working experience with the different types of operative procedures and anesthetic agents currently used so as to be prepared to provide optimum care for the patient in the immediate post-operative phase of anesthesia

Responsibilities

  • Provide optimal patient care in the immediate post-operative phase of anesthesia and surgery
  • Notifies physician and anesthetist of any adverse alteration in patient’s physical status and initiates emergency measures
  • Notifies Diagnostic Imaging, Laboratory, Cardiopulmonary, or Pharmacy of physicians’ requests regarding immediate post-operative needs
  • Restocks supplies, at the end of the day, which have been used during the course of the day
  • Regulates, monitors, maintains, and documents all intravenous fluids that the patient receives in the PACU
  • Maintains accurate records of all vital signs, drains, and special equipment used on patient for recovery
